Changes for version v3.1.100 - 2020-01-28
- REGRESSIONS
- temporarily drop subject license pattern from object afl (clashes with those of versioned child objects)
- Bug Fixes
- tighten object adobe_2006 pattern grant to avoid false positives
- Documentation
- add description for license objects apache_1 apache_1_1
- update TODO
- Test Suite
- test actually used name pattern for adobe_2006 object
- Other
- add Trove captions; add trait object license_label_trove; synthesize subject pattern grant from Trove caption
- add tag license:contains:* for license objects apache_1 apache_1_1 bsd_3_clause bsd_4_clause dsdp
- extend subject license patterns for license objects apache_1 apache_1_1 apache_2 bsd_2_clause bsd_3_clause bsd_4_clause dsdp
- relax leading bullet to be optional (might be misdetected as comment marker and stripped)
- relax object gpl to match bogus name "the GNU License"
- relax slightly internal pattern copr_cond_discl
- relax trait pattern licensed_under to cover more phrases
- relax trait pattern licensed_under to cover more phrases
- relax trait pattern licensed_under to cover more phrases
- tighten trait object version_number to cover only single-digit segment
Modules
Regular expressions for legal licenses
Regular expressions for licensing sub-parts